LusoRobótica - Robótica em Português

Software => Software e Programação => Tópico iniciado por: ivitro em 19 de Dezembro de 2011, 15:31

Título: Programa para fazer relatorios manutenção
Enviado por: ivitro em 19 de Dezembro de 2011, 15:31
Boas,

Vou começar a fazer um pequeno programa para auxiliar o meu pai a fazer uns relatórios de manutenção.

Vou ter como entrada:

-Máquina
-Obra
-Data

Depois queria fazer uma pesquisa também por máquina, obra e data para se poder imprimir.


Eu fazia isto em C mas a GUI não seria a mais amigável e a base de dados talvez não ficasse a melhor, então preciso de alguma orientação de qual a melhor forma de fazer isto.

 
Título: Re: Programa para fazer relatorios manutenção
Enviado por: TigPT em 19 de Dezembro de 2011, 15:33
Não sou muito amigo das ferramentas office mas para o que pretendes o melhor é sem dúvida Microsoft Access (http://pt.wikipedia.org/wiki/Microsoft_Access)
Título: Re: Programa para fazer relatorios manutenção
Enviado por: ivitro em 19 de Dezembro de 2011, 15:37
Mas depois dá para abrir como se fosse um programa independente do Access?
Título: Re: Programa para fazer relatorios manutenção
Enviado por: TigPT em 19 de Dezembro de 2011, 15:39
Sim, depois do formulário criado podes gerar uma view em exe (agora não me perguntes como que não vejo Access desde à uns 7 anos.

Se o PC em questão tiver net, podes usar o google docs para criar o formulário que sempre que é finalizado preenche um excell com os dados inseridos.
Título: Re: Programa para fazer relatorios manutenção
Enviado por: musicbox em 19 de Dezembro de 2011, 15:43
Experimenta o MS Project ou o ManWinWin, por exemplo. Permitem que planeies acções de manutenção, com um elevado grau de liberdade, fazendo inclusive cálculo de custos associados aos vários processos.
Título: Re: Programa para fazer relatorios manutenção
Enviado por: zordlyon em 19 de Dezembro de 2011, 15:55
Um pouco Overkill mas sempre fazes tudo como queres é fazeres a Base de dados em PostGres por exemplo e depois é programação Java para cima...

E fazes a interface e a ligação a BD como quiseres...

Cumprimentos,
André Carvalho.
Título: Re: Programa para fazer relatorios manutenção
Enviado por: senso em 19 de Dezembro de 2011, 17:01
Eu tambem iria para Access pela simpicidade que te trás, foi feito precisamente para isso.
Título: Re: Programa para fazer relatorios manutenção
Enviado por: SJD22 em 19 de Dezembro de 2011, 22:02
Se queres para web tenta asp ou php q é de borla...
Título: Re: Programa para fazer relatorios manutenção
Enviado por: ivitro em 19 de Dezembro de 2011, 23:39
Não necessito que seja orientado para web.

obrigado pelas dicas, vou começar a meter mãos à obra depois posto o resultado  ;)
Título: Re: Programa para fazer relatorios manutenção
Enviado por: Igor Moreira em 20 de Dezembro de 2011, 01:13
Não entendo de  banco de dados, mas se você quer criar um interface com grande facilidade usa a linguagem C#, muito fácil de se criar interface gráfica.
Título: Re: Programa para fazer relatorios manutenção
Enviado por: musicbox em 20 de Dezembro de 2011, 11:51
Um pouco Overkill mas sempre fazes tudo como queres é fazeres a Base de dados em PostGres por exemplo e depois é programação Java para cima...

E fazes a interface e a ligação a BD como quiseres...

Cumprimentos,
André Carvalho.

A intenção era, caso não estivesse familiarizado com as tarefas de manutenção e afins, dar uma vista de olhos nos programas que mencionei para ter uma base de trabalho. E que melhor base de trabalho, que os programas utilizados para esses fins?

Cumprimentos,
Rúben Gomes
Título: Re: Programa para fazer relatorios manutenção
Enviado por: zordlyon em 20 de Dezembro de 2011, 11:54
Sim existem programas para esses fins é claro, mas julgo que quem perguntou tinha a ideia de fazer o seu proprio programa, daí ter mencionado java e postgres...
 ;)

Cumprimentos,
André Carvalho.
Título: Re: Programa para fazer relatorios manutenção
Enviado por: ivitro em 20 de Dezembro de 2011, 13:06
sim a ideia é fazer o próprio programa.

Já tenho ideia do que quero nesta fase inicial, depois mais tarde tenho outras ideias (organização das tarefas preventivas).

Estive a tentar fazer algumas coisas simples no Acess mas não tive sucesso.

Vou arriscar no C#, e no Visual Studio para esta tarefa.
Título: Re: Programa para fazer relatorios manutenção
Enviado por: Sextafeira em 20 de Dezembro de 2011, 14:01

podes fazer uma BD em mysql que é super simples, e depois fazes uma ligação ao visual basic, podes usar tcp/ip para comunicação acho que é a mais simples

o mysql é mais simples que o access ou mesmo utilizares o datagridview no visula basic

na net podes encontrar muitos exemplos .

cumps
Título: Re: Programa para fazer relatorios manutenção
Enviado por: zordlyon em 20 de Dezembro de 2011, 14:21
Lembro-me no meu 12º ano ter feito um programa de facturação e gestão de correspondencia em Visual Basic 6 e Access 2003, e realmente é muito simples...  ;)

Cumprimentos,
André Carvalho.